WF12 GHG is a 2012 Suzuki Jimny in Black with a 1,298c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 2012 Suzuki Jimny models, the average MOT pass rate is 82.5% with a typical mileage of 38,581 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Suzuki Jimny f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 18,210 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WF12 GHG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Suzuki Jimny typ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 14 years old, this Suzuki Jimny is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
